  • 復溶:
    We recommend that this vial be briefly centrifuged prior to opening to bring the contents to the bottom. Please reconstitute protein in deionized sterile water to a concentration of 0.1-1.0 mg/mL.We recommend to add 5-50% of glycerol (final concentration) and aliquot for long-term storage at -20℃/-80℃. Our default final concentration of glycerol is 50%. Customers could use it as reference.
  • 儲存條件:
    Store at -20°C/-80°C upon receipt, aliquoting is necessary for mutiple use. Avoid repeated freeze-thaw cycles.
  • 保質期:
    The shelf life is related to many factors, storage state, buffer ingredients, storage temperature and the stability of the protein itself.
    Generally, the shelf life of liquid form is 6 months at -20°C/-80°C. The shelf life of lyophilized form is 12 months at -20°C/-80°C.

  • 功能:
    Transcription factor that plays a key role in several developmental processes, including neurogenesis, chondrocytes differentiation and cartilage formation. Specifically binds the 5'-AACAAT-3' DNA motif present in enhancers and super-enhancers and promotes expression of genes important for chondrogenesis. Required for overt chondrogenesis when condensed prechondrocytes differentiate into early stage chondrocytes: SOX5 and SOX6 cooperatively bind with SOX9 on active enhancers and super-enhancers associated with cartilage-specific genes, and thereby potentiate SOX9's ability to transactivate. Not involved in precartilaginous condensation, the first step in chondrogenesis, during which skeletal progenitors differentiate into prechondrocytes. Together with SOX5, required to form and maintain a pool of highly proliferating chondroblasts between epiphyses and metaphyses, to form columnar chondroblasts, delay chondrocyte prehypertrophy but promote hypertrophy, and to delay terminal differentiation of chondrocytes on contact with ossification fronts. Binds to the proximal promoter region of the myelin protein MPZ gene, and is thereby involved in the differentiation of oligodendroglia in the developing spinal tube. Binds to the gene promoter of MBP and acts as a transcriptional repressor.
  • 基因功能參考文獻:
    1. These data demonstrate functional cooperation between Sox6 and Nfix in regulating MyHC-I expression during prenatal muscle development. PMID: 27880909
    2. Sox6 plays an important role in suppressing cell proliferation and modulating fetal gene expression during postnatal heart development. PMID: 27832192
    3. findings suggest that Sox6 contributes to cell survival by suppressing BMP-4 transcription during neuronal differentiation PMID: 26590087
    4. We found that miR-21 acts as a bidirectional switch in the formation of IPCs by regulating the expression of target and downstream genes (SOX6, RPBJ and HES1). PMID: 26655730
    5. Loss of Trbp function results in upregulation of Sox6. PMID: 26029872
    6. After cell-cycle exit, Sox6 selectively localizes to substantia nigra pars compacta neurons, while Otx2 and Nolz1 are expressed in a subset of ventral tegmental area neurons. PMID: 25127144
    7. miR-499 regulates the proliferation and apoptosis of embryonic stem cells cells in the late stage of cardiac differentiation via its effects on Sox6 and cyclin D1. PMID: 24040263
    8. Its transactivation during chondrogenesis is negatively regulated by Per1 protein. PMID: 23883486
    9. during development, Sox6 functions as a transcriptional suppressor of fiber type-specific and developmental isoform genes to promote functional specification of muscle which is critical for optimum muscle performance and health. PMID: 21985497
    10. These results identify Sox6 as a robust regulator of muscle contractile phenotype and metabolism, and elucidate a mechanism by which functionally related muscle fiber-type specific gene isoforms are collectively controlled. PMID: 21633012
    11. Data show that Stat3 is required for Sox6 expression during neuronal differentiation. PMID: 21094641
    12. Sox6 is necessary for efficient erythropoiesis in adult mice under both basal and stress conditions. PMID: 20711497
    13. Sox6 is required for notochord extracellular matrix sheath formation, notochord cell survival and formation of nuclei pulposi PMID: 12571105
    14. Sox6 overexpression causes cellular aggregation and neuronal differentiation of P19 embryonal carcinoma cells in the absence of tretinoin. PMID: 14988021
    15. Sox6 likely plays an important role in muscle development PMID: 16124007
    16. Perturbations in transcriptional regulation that are coordinated through SOX6 and PDX1 in beta-cells may contribute to the beta-cell adaptation in obesity-related insulin resistance. PMID: 16148004
    17. Sox6 is required for silencing of epsilony globin in definitive erythropoiesis and may have a role in erythroid cell maturation PMID: 16462943
    18. SOX6 may be an important factor in obesity-related insulin resistance PMID: 17412698
    19. Thus, we successfully identified the Sox6 promoter and its core enhancer and characterized the interactions with regulatory transcription factors. PMID: 17433257
    20. Sox6 plays a critical role in the fiber type differentiation of fetal skeletal muscle; the MyHC-beta promoter revealed a Sox consensus sequence that likely functions as a negative cis-regulatory element PMID: 17584907
    21. The data of this study indicated that SOX6 is a central regulator of both progenitor and cortical interneuron diversity during neocortical development. PMID: 19657336
